Matches in DBpedia 2016-04 for { ?s ?p "The Mercury Turnpike Cruiser is a full-size automobile that was Mercury's flagship model in 1957 and 1958. The Turnpike Cruiser was produced in two body styles: a two-door and four-door hardtop were offered. In 1957 a convertible was produced, serving as the pace car for the Indianapolis 500 of that year. The name was inspired by the creation of the United States Interstate Highway System that was begun in 1956.At introduction of the 1957 line up the Turnpike Cruiser series offered two- and four-door hardtop body styles. They are best known for the unique styling cues and wide array of gadgets including a \"Breezeway\" power rear window that could be lowered to improve ventilation, \"twin jet\" air intakes at upper corners of car's windshield, \"seat-o-matic\" automatically adjusting seat, and an average speed \"computer\" (that would tell your average speed at any point along a trip)."@en }
